Study Levels
|
BEGINNER |
|
You will learn basic communication skills for everyday life for example, asking for information about hotels, restaurants, tourist information etc. You will learn the most common Spanish verbs and you will be able to tell a doctor about your health, were it hurts and so forth. You will be able to hold a basic conversation on simple subjects. |
|
INTERMEDIATE |
|
You will be able to communicate at a general level and be able to speak and write in the 3 principal tenses of grammar (present, past and future). Furthermore you will be able to communicate with fluidity. You will be able to talk about more complex subjects eg: politics, music, life styles etc. |
|
ADVANCED |
|
You will be able to speak fluently about any subject, you will learn advanced grammar such as the subjunctive, which does not exists in some languages. You will be able to debate, explain and describe, and write lengthy editorials with a high level of and most importantly, correct Spanish. You will be able to read and understand poetry, songs and much more.

TEACHING METHOD |
|
Our method is based on the four main skills: speaking, writing, conversation and grammar. Our teachers do not speak in any other language other than Spanish, unless it is absolutely necessary - this is the best way to learn another language. |
